On Mon, Aug 20, 2012 at 08:53:55PM +0400, Sergei Poselenov wrote:
> On our system (ARM Cortex-M3 SOC running linux-2.6.33 with
> compat-wireless-3.4-rc3-1 modules configured for rt2x00) frequent
Please remove compat-wireless reference here and in the subject.

> crashes were observed in rt2800usb module because of the invalid
> length of the received packet (3392, 46920...). This patch adds
> the sanity check on the packet legth. In case of the bad length,
> mark the packet as with CRC error.

> +	if (rx_pkt_len > entry->skb->len) {
> +		rxdesc->flags |= RX_FLAG_FAILED_FCS_CRC;
> +		goto procrxwi;

I would rather prefer something like 

if (unlikely(rx_pkt_len == 0 || rx_pkt_len > entry->queue->data_size)) {
 	/* Process error in rt2x00lib_rxdone() */
	rxdesc->size = rx_pkt_len;
	return;
}
